The Role of Human Behaviour

Humans can be cybersecurity’s strongest asset or its biggest weakness. Every click, password created, and personal detail shared plays a crucial role in maintaining digital security.

Actions like using the same password for multiple accounts or clicking on a suspicious link out of curiosity can lead to breaches that compromise sensitive data. It is through understanding these behaviours that cyberpsychology aims to shore up our digital defenses.

Employees often underestimate their importance in keeping company information safe. Simple acts such as setting robust passwords, reporting unusual computer behaviour, and being cautious with email attachments are critical in defending against cyber threats.

Cybersecurity education strives to turn automatic actions into conscious security measures by highlighting how everyday habits impact the overall safety of digital systems.

Insider Threats

Insider threats pose a significant risk to digital security, often arising from within an organisation. Individuals with access to sensitive data can intentionally or unintentionally compromise it.

These threats may include employees, contractors, or business partners who exploit their privileges for personal gain or inadvertently become the targets of cybercriminals seeking unauthorised access.

Understanding the psychology behind insider threats is crucial in protecting against them. Incorporating human-focused cybersecurity education and awareness programmes can empower individuals to recognise suspicious behaviour and mitigate potential risks.

Social Engineering

Moving from the threat of insider breaches to another significant challenge in cybersecurity, social engineering emerges as a technique used by cybercriminals to manipulate individuals into divulging sensitive information or performing certain actions.

Social engineering preys on human psychology and emotions, often exploiting trust or fear to gain access to confidential data. With this in mind, users should remain cautious of unsolicited messages, emails, or phone calls that request personal information.

Furthermore, keeping software up to date is crucial for safeguarding against potential vulnerabilities that can be exploited through social engineering tactics.

The Impact of Organisational Policies and Culture

Organisational policies and culture significantly influence cybersecurity practices within a company. By setting clear guidelines and expectations regarding information security, organisations can create a framework for employees to follow, reducing the risk of data breaches caused by human error.

Moreover, fostering a culture of awareness and accountability ensures that every individual understands their role in upholding digital security standards. This approach helps in mitigating insider threats and social engineering attempts.

The incorporation of cybersecurity education into organisational training programs is essential as it equips employees with the knowledge and skills required to identify potential risks and respond appropriately.
